Born in Santiago, Chile, Zamorano started his football career at a club in Chile called Terrasantino, and soon he made a name for himself in the South American league. In line with the booming european trend in South America at that time, he came to the European League early. St. Gallen, Seville, Real Madrid, after leaving an indelible mark on the Iberian Peninsula, his next stop is his home, Inter Milan.

This is a period of unremitting efforts, unremitting struggle, willingness to dedicate everything. In five seasons, he made 149 appearances in all competitions and scored 41 goals. Hard work, continuous efforts, his dedication infects that Inter Milan continue to move forward, continue to pursue. In the 1997/98 season, Inter Milan won the UEFA Cup, and it was Zamorano who opened the record for the Nerazzurri in the final, a goal that he later considered the best goal of his career.
